- sketch the graph of an exponential function using transformations and find its domain, range and horizontal asymptote- week 13 - (section 4.1)
- ( y = -3^{-0.5x} + 2 )
Step1: Analyze the parent function
The parent exponential function is \( y = 3^x \). Its domain is \( (-\infty, \infty) \), range is \( (0, \infty) \), and horizontal asymptote is \( y = 0 \).
Step2: Apply horizontal stretch/compression
For \( y = 3^{-0.5x} \), the exponent has a coefficient of \(-0.5\). The horizontal stretch factor is \( \frac{1}{| - 0.5|}=2 \), and the negative sign reflects the graph over the \( y \)-axis. So \( y = 3^{-0.5x} \) is a horizontal stretch by a factor of 2 and reflection over the \( y \)-axis of \( y = 3^x \). Its domain is still \( (-\infty, \infty) \), range \( (0, \infty) \), horizontal asymptote \( y = 0 \).
Step3: Apply vertical reflection
For \( y=-3^{-0.5x} \), the negative sign reflects the graph of \( y = 3^{-0.5x} \) over the \( x \)-axis. Now the range becomes \( (-\infty, 0) \), domain \( (-\infty, \infty) \), horizontal asymptote \( y = 0 \).
Step4: Apply vertical shift
For \( y=-3^{-0.5x}+2 \), we shift the graph of \( y=-3^{-0.5x} \) up by 2 units.
Domain:
Exponential functions with real - valued exponents have a domain of all real numbers. So the domain of \( y=-3^{-0.5x}+2 \) is \( (-\infty, \infty) \).
Range:
The range of \( y=-3^{-0.5x} \) is \( (-\infty, 0) \). When we shift it up by 2 units, we add 2 to each \( y \) - value. So the range of \( y=-3^{-0.5x}+2 \) is \( (-\infty, 2) \).
Horizontal Asymptote:
The horizontal asymptote of \( y=-3^{-0.5x} \) is \( y = 0 \). After shifting up by 2 units, the horizontal asymptote becomes \( y=2 \).
Sketching the graph:
- Start with the parent function \( y = 3^x \) (increasing, passes through \( (0,1) \)).
- Reflect over the \( y \)-axis and stretch horizontally by a factor of 2 to get \( y = 3^{-0.5x} \) (decreasing, passes through \( (0,1) \)).
- Reflect over the \( x \)-axis to get \( y=-3^{-0.5x} \) (increasing, passes through \( (0, - 1) \)).
- Shift up by 2 units to get \( y=-3^{-0.5x}+2 \) (increasing, passes through \( (0,1) \)).
